ODBIERZ TWÓJ BONUS :: »

C# 7.0. Kompletny przewodnik dla praktyków. Wydanie VI Mark Michaelis

(ebook) (audiobook) (audiobook)
Autor:
Mark Michaelis
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
5.5/6  Opinie: 6
Stron:
840
Druk:
oprawa twarda
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
niedostępna
Powiadom mnie, gdy książka będzie dostępna

Ebook
64,50 zł 129,00 zł (-50%)
64,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Sprawdź nowe wydanie

C# 8.0. Kompletny przewodnik dla praktyków. Wydanie VII
Mark Michaelis
C# jest jednym z najlepszych dzieł Microsoftu - cechuje go dojrzałość, prostota i nowoczesność. Został zaprojektowany jako język obiektowy i konsekwentnie jest rozwijany. Służy do tworzenia aplikacji sieciowych, mikrousług, aplikacji desktopowych, oprogramowania dla urządzeń mobilnych i internetu rzeczy. Ponadto C# jest językiem otwartym, pozwalającym na pisanie kodu bezpiecznego, przejrzystego, wydajnego i prostego w konserwacji. W wersji 8.0 pojawiły się funkcjonalności, które jeszcze b...

Czego się nauczysz?

  • Tworzenia, kompilowania i uruchamiania projektów w C# 7.0 z użyciem Visual Studio i Dotnet CLI
  • Stosowania podstawowych i zaawansowanych typów danych, w tym krotek, typów anonimowych i tablic
  • Zarządzania przepływem sterowania za pomocą instrukcji warunkowych, pętli i operatorów
  • Deklarowania i wywoływania metod z różnymi rodzajami parametrów (ref, out, in, params)
  • Obsługi wyjątków, definiowania własnych wyjątków i stosowania bloków try-catch-finally
  • Tworzenia i wykorzystywania klas, konstruktorów, właściwości, metod statycznych i częściowych
  • Implementowania dziedziczenia, polimorfizmu oraz pracy z klasami abstrakcyjnymi i sealed
  • Definiowania i implementowania interfejsów oraz korzystania z polimorfizmu opartego na interfejsach
  • Pracy z typami bezpośrednimi (strukturami, wyliczeniami) i stosowania opakowywania
  • Przesłaniania metod z klasy object oraz przeciążania operatorów dla własnych typów
  • Tworzenia i wykorzystywania typów generycznych, interfejsów i metod generycznych
  • Stosowania delegatów, wyrażeń lambda i wzorca publikuj-subskrybuj ze zdarzeniami
  • Pracy z kolekcjami, interfejsami IEnumerable, IList, IDictionary oraz implementowania iteratorów
  • Wykorzystywania technologii LINQ do filtrowania, sortowania, grupowania i projekcji danych
  • Tworzenia niestandardowych kolekcji i implementowania własnych iteratorów
  • Stosowania refleksji, atrybutów i podstaw programowania dynamicznego w C#

C# jest jednym z lepiej dopracowanych języków programowania. Cechują go dojrzałość, prostota, nowoczesność i bezpieczeństwo. Został od podstaw zaprojektowany jako obiektowy. Stanowi integralną część platformy Microsoft .NET Framework. Jest ulubionym narzędziem profesjonalnych programistów, którym zależy na pisaniu kodu bezpiecznego, przejrzystego, wydajnego i prostego w konserwacji. W wersji 7.0 tego języka pojawiły się nowe usprawnienia, dzięki którym programowanie stało się jeszcze bardziej efektywne i satysfakcjonujące.

Ta książka jest szóstym, zaktualizowanym i uzupełnionym wydaniem jednego z najlepszych podręczników programowania. Poza znakomitym kompendium języka C# znalazły się tu informacje o poszczególnych metodykach programowania, od sekwencyjnego aż po podstawy programowania deklaratywnego z wykorzystaniem atrybutów. Szczegółowo przedstawiono funkcje wprowadzone do wersji 7.0 języka, a także w platformie .NET Framework 4.7/.NET Core 2.0. Książka jest też wygodnym źródłem wiedzy o pewnych rzadko stosowanych konstrukcjach składniowych, specyficznych szczegółach i subtelnościach języka C#. Jasny i przejrzysty sposób prezentowania treści pozwoli na szybkie zrozumienie nawet najbardziej zawiłych zagadnień.

W tej książce między innymi:

  • przewodnik po C# oraz różne paradygmaty programowania
  • interfejsy, dziedziczenie, typy bezpośrednie
  • obsługa wyjątków
  • delegaty, technologia LINQ i mechanizm refleksji
  • zarządzanie wątkami i programowanie asynchroniczne

C#. Nowoczesny, elegancki, bezpieczny!

Wybrane bestsellery

O autorze książki

Mark Michaelis jest autorytetem w dziedzinie tworzenia zaawansowanego oprogramowania. Zabiera głos na prestiżowych konferencjach dla programistów. Obecnie prowadzi kolumnę Essential .NET w „MSDN Magazine”. Od 1996 roku posiada tytuł Microsoft MVP. W 2007 roku został dyrektorem regionalnym Microsoftu, jest też członkiem kilku zespołów oceniających projekty oprogramowania tej firmy (między innymi języka C# i technologii VSTS).

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y książka omawia nowości wprowadzone w C# 7.0 oraz platformie .NET Core 2.0/.NET Framework 4.7?
Tak, książka szczegółowo opisuje nowe funkcje i usprawnienia wprowadzone w C# 7.0 oraz zmiany w platformach .NET Core 2.0 i .NET Framework 4.7.
2. Czy publikacja zawiera przykłady kodu i praktyczne ćwiczenia?
Tak, w książce znajdziesz liczne przykłady kodu, praktyczne wskazówki oraz mapy myśli pomagające w zrozumieniu zagadnień programistycznych.
3. Czy do książki dołączone są materiały dodatkowe, takie jak kod źródłowy?
Tak, autor udostępnia kod źródłowy do przykładów omawianych w książce, co ułatwia naukę i samodzielne eksperymentowanie.
4. Na jakim poziomie zaawansowania jest książka - czy nadaje się dla osób początkujących w C#?
Książka obejmuje zarówno podstawowe, jak i zaawansowane zagadnienia, dzięki czemu może służyć jako przewodnik dla osób rozpoczynających naukę, jak i dla programistów chcących pogłębić swoją wiedzę.
5. Czy książka porusza temat programowania obiektowego i innych paradygmatów programowania w C#?
Tak, publikacja szeroko omawia programowanie obiektowe oraz inne metodyki, takie jak programowanie sekwencyjne i deklaratywne.
6. Czy książka uwzględnia różnice między wersjami C# i .NET oraz wyjaśnia kompatybilność?
Tak, autor wyjaśnia różnice między wersjami języka oraz platform .NET, a także omawia kwestie kompatybilności i standardów.
7. Jak mogę kupić książkę i czy jest dostępna w wersji elektronicznej (ebook)?
Książkę można zamówić bezpośrednio na Helion.pl. Informacja o dostępności wersji elektronicznej znajduje się na stronie produktu.
8. Czy książka nadaje się jako materiał do nauki samodzielnej lub do pracy w grupie/studiach?
Tak, książka została napisana w sposób umożliwiający zarówno samodzielną naukę, jak i wykorzystanie jej jako podręcznika podczas kursów, szkoleń czy studiów.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ki
Proszę czekać...
ajax-loader

Zamknij

Wybierz metodę płatności

Książka
129,00 zł
Niedostępna
Ebook
64,50 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Ebookpoint